DR. TODD H. BULLARD yjreszbfenf A college yearbook appeals to many kinds of interests and to many levels ofconcern. For most alumni, l suppose, the yearbook achieves its greatest impact at a point in time far removed from the date of graduation. We look back then to see the physical changes in ourselves, in others, and in the campus. We marvel that friends and acquaintances can have grown so bald, or fat, or old. We wonder how education could have been accomplished in such inadequate facilities. The moral is that ceaseless change affects us all and that the camera in freezing people and places at a mo- ment in time gives us a sharp insight into the impact of change upon individual lives and well-loved places.
